And we open with Booker T. vs. Benoit. I can dig that, sucka. They start with a handshake. They end with a low blow via Sharmell straight to Benoit's under parts (in 1988, I actually saved him from the vet's knife as well). Booker T is your new champ. Booker is so oblivious to his wife's help that it's actually funny. And believe it or not this isn't the last good match, nor the last funny moment tonight. Man, in the middle of that match, Benoit tried a suicide plancha through the second rope, missed, and landed small of the back first on the announcer's table--which didn't give! It got a holy shit from the crowd and from me. That really looked like it hurt. Almost as much as a knife to the sack.
